Understanding the Parcel Fabric
The parcel fabric serves as the digital backbone of land ownership and boundary representation within a GIS environment. It's the authoritative model that ties legal descriptions, ownership records, and spatial geometry together into a single, coherent system. Historically, however, this model has struggled to represent condominiums accurately — a single footprint on a map might conceal dozens or even hundreds of individual units stacked vertically, each with its own ownership interest, boundaries, and attributes.
By incorporating true condo units directly into the parcel fabric, governments can finally close that gap. Rather than relying on generalized polygons or supplementary spreadsheets to track condominium interests, agencies gain a comprehensive, spatially accurate depiction of Condominium Real Interests as legally defined. This allows anyone consuming the data — assessors, appraisers, title companies, prospective buyers, or members of the public — to understand far more than just "a unit exists here." They can see the unit's size, its layout, its orientation within the building, its elevation relative to other units, and its spatial relationship to surrounding properties, common elements, and neighborhood amenities. In short, the data finally matches the reality it's meant to represent.
Panda Consulting's Approach
Panda Consulting leverages advanced GIS technology to build highly detailed, highly accurate visualization models of condominium units, limited common elements, and general common elements, all grounded firmly in the legal definitions set forth in each property's Declaration of Condominium. We don't generalize or approximate — every model we build is traceable back to the governing legal documents that define ownership and use rights.
Our process begins with close collaboration. Our team of experts works directly with your staff to gather all the source materials necessary to build an accurate model, including:
Condominium declarations and amendments
Site surveys and as-built drawings
Architectural plans and floor plans
Other relevant recorded documents
From there, our team carefully "scrubs" this information, extracting the relevant spatial and legal attribution needed to construct true parcel fabric parcels. Each resulting parcel carries the essential attribution required to accurately visualize the elevation, shape, and exact area of every condominium unit, limited common element, and general common element — transforming dense legal documentation into clean, usable, spatially accurate GIS data.Benefits of 3D Condo Unit Visualization
Benefits of 3D Condo Unit Visualization
3D Visualization
Immersive, Realistic Visualization
Three-dimensional visualization models offer a far more intuitive and engaging way to understand condominium properties than traditional flat maps ever could. Viewers can see exactly how a unit sits within its building, how it relates to the units above and below it, and how the entire structure fits within the surrounding parcel fabric — giving everyone from government staff to the general public an immediate, accurate sense of spatial context that text-based records simply cannot convey.
Improved Decision-Making
When the size, layout, elevation, and orientation of a unit are clearly visualized rather than buried in legal text, the people who rely on that data — appraisers, assessors, lenders, real estate professionals, and everyday property owners — can make far more informed decisions. Accurate spatial data reduces ambiguity, minimizes disputes over boundaries and ownership interests, and builds greater public confidence in the records your agency maintains.
Greater Data Integrity and Consistency
Because every visualization is built directly from the Declaration of Condominium and supporting legal documents, the resulting data isn't just visually compelling — it's authoritative. This creates a single, consistent source of truth that aligns legal ownership records with spatial GIS data, reducing discrepancies between what's recorded and what's mapped.
